Profile bio

About Eric Jensen

• Geospatial data scientist with nearly a decade of experience in remote sensing, spatial data analysis, spatial statistics, cartography, data visualization, time-series analysis, tool development, and ecological modeling.• Strong technical proficiencies in Google Earth Engine, R, GIS (ArcGIS and QGIS). Also works in Python, MATLAB, Linux, and web development• Subject matter emphasis on spatial ecology, landscape ecology, rangeland ecosystems, post-fire vegetation recovery.• Developer of multiple natural resources management decision-support tools using remotely sensed datasets and multiple regional modeling analyses.
